Users of the JioSphere web browser have recently come across JioCoin, a crypto token built on Ethereum Layer 2 technology. Featured on Polygon Labs, JioCoin offers users the opportunity to earn rewards simply by browsing the web using JioSphere or interacting with Jio’s suite of apps. Although Reliance has yet to make an official announcement, JioCoin is already sparking curiosity among Android and iOS users.

Ways to Earn JioCoins
According to Reliance’s FAQ section, JioCoins are blockchain-powered reward tokens linked to Indian mobile numbers. Users can earn JioCoins by using JioSphere or engaging with apps like MyJio and JioCinema. The tokens are automatically stored in Polygon Labs’ digital wallet, providing a safe and efficient way for users to manage their earnings.
Potential Applications of JioCoin
It is speculated that JioCoins may be used for various services, including mobile recharges, utility bill payments, and transactions within the Jio ecosystem. This initiative aims to enhance user experience by seamlessly integrating blockchain technology into everyday activities. However, specifics about JioCoin’s monetary value and trading features remain unconfirmed.

Taxation and Legal Aspects
In India, cryptocurrency earnings are subject to a 30% tax on profits, along with a 1% tax deduction at source (TDS). These rules are expected to apply to JioCoin transactions as well, highlighting the importance of understanding tax obligations. Despite recent setbacks in India’s cryptocurrency market, JioCoin’s introduction signifies Reliance’s belief in the potential of blockchain technology.
The Future of Blockchain in India
The WazirX breach raised concerns about cryptocurrency’s security among Indian users. However, the global rise of tokens like Bitcoin showcases the resilience of blockchain-based solutions. With JioCoin, Reliance aims to merge utility, security, and innovation, paving the way for wider blockchain adoption in India.
An official announcement is anticipated soon, shedding light on JioCoin’s features and its role in the digital economy.
